Pest Control: Prevalent Family and Firm Pests

Rodents (Rats and Mice)

When it relates to identifying rodent invasions in your New Jersey home, awareness is essential. You possibly see dung near food sources, in cabinets, or below sinks. Bite marks on food wrapping, wood, and electrical cords are obvious evidence of their presence. At night, you may perceive scraping noises in partitions, top boundaries, or beneath floors as these nocturnal animals become energetic. If you locate dwellings produced from fragmented stationery, fibers, or dried plant matter, that's a distinct indication rodents have set up themselves settled. Slimy rub marks beside baseboards and surfaces emerge as rodents apply the same paths frequently, while your pets may reveal peculiar conduct such as yelping or digging at spots beneath machines or furniture where rodents shelter.

Rats and mice in New Jersey homes and organizations present several threats exceeding only disturbance. They can pollute food and creation zones with infectious agents residing in their urination and dung. Their incessant necessity to nibble can harm belongings, specifically cords, which creates fire risks. In Matawan and encompassing regions, the Norway rat and house mouse are particularly difficult, prospering in both city and bedroom community environments. Productive Pest Control measures are crucial to handle these detrimental invaders.

Invertebrates (Ants, Cockroaches, Bed Bugs)

Arthropod invasions show themselves in different modes based on the kind. Ant problems become apparent when you observe obvious ant trails approaching food reserves, or when you uncover minor heaps of soil or wood shavings made by carpenter ants. Cockroach incursions often present themselves through dark excrement akin to coffee grounds or black pepper, a singular musty fragrance that suffuses contaminated regions, and the occurrence of egg envelopes in hidden corners. Bed bug infestations manifest as rust-colored marks on mattresses and fixtures, shed skins near lounging spots, little blood discolorations on sheets, and itchy red welts on skin typically aligned in a row or collection.

Arthropods constitute the most assorted variety of pests in New Jersey. Cockroaches can set off asthma and sensitivities while spreading countless microorganisms. Bed bugs, while not disease carriers, cause marked soreness, sleep disturbance, and affective distress. Certain ant varieties, like carpenter ants prevalent in Monmouth County's forested zones, can cause structural impairment akin to termites during time. Specialized Pest Control companies can spot distinct insect classes and apply precise approach methods that manage the singular conducts and vulnerabilities of each pest.

Termites

Finding termite presence promptly calls for grasping the nuanced symptoms of their manifestation. You perhaps detect abandoned wings near casements and entries after swarmers have located a mate and established a new group. Mud tubes on outdoor sides, timber beams, or in crawl regions operate as safeguarded highways for these devastating pests. Wood that resonates unfilled when knocked indicates termites have been feasting from within. Portals and openings that quickly adhere may reveal distorting from termite harm, while broken or bubbling paint akin to water injury often conceals termite movement underneath. Detecting frass—termite droppings reminiscent of diminutive wood-colored granules—supplies another confirmation of their undesired manifestation.

Termites form perhaps the most significant architectural hazard within all common pests. In New Jersey, the Eastern subterranean termite is common and especially detrimental. These organisms can continue concealed for spans while making widespread impairment to timber framework constituents. Environmentally-Friendly Pest Control Solutions

Comprehensive Pest Management (IPM) System

Combined Pest Control represents the premium benchmark in modern pest control, concentrating on long-term deterrence through a combination of methods that reduce natural impact while optimizing efficiency. The IPM process begins with thorough examination and observation to recognize pest activity correctly, creating foundation details about types found and number counts. This results in accurate classification of pest kinds, confirming control attempts address specific patterns and exposures rather than implementing broad procedures. Professionals determine limit levels that require intervention, acknowledging that the basic detection of a limited pests does not inevitably need action if amounts stay below injurious amounts. When treatment turns necessary, IPM uses various management techniques in combination, typically initiating with least-toxic methods and increasing only when necessary. Throughout the process, professionals assess success and change methods as needed, building a flexible strategy responsive to changing conditions. Most vitally, IPM highlights deterrence over treatment, dealing with construction and surrounding aspects that encourage pest communities rather than simply destroying existing pests. Many pest control companies in New Jersey offer IPM-based programs that align with the state's drive toward safer pest treatment practices, notably in critical locations like learning institutions, health institutions, and meal preparation operations.

Natural Management Approaches

Successful pest control often incorporates natural strategies that can fix or minimize pest concerns without introducing products into the surroundings. Tangible barriers such as mesh, door sweeps, and sealing block pest access entirely, tackling the issue at its root. Mechanical controls like traps and blocking devices take away present pests while blocking new entries. Natural approaches containing beneficial organisms and organisms bring organic enemies that focus on individual pests while keeping useful insects unharmed. Environmental approaches alter the conditions to repel creatures, such as adjusting water schedules to minimize dampness that lures particular pests. Living space alteration lowers hiding places and feeding resources, making sites reduced attractive to problematic occupants. For certain creatures like bed bugs, heat procedures deliver exceptionally productive elimination without toxic remains by boosting temperatures beyond the heat lethal threshold for all living phases of the intended pest. In the same way, refrigeration approaches for kept item organisms like food beetles or food storage pests can eradicate invasions in nutritional products without toxic exposure. These methods show notably important in New Jersey's different settings, where closeness to aquatic areas, conserved wild locations, and dense residential zones forms various circumstances where chemical decrease turns wanted or essential.

Can I avoid insects without pest control chemicals?

Certainly, numerous organisms can be stopped through proper cleanliness, blocking, and living space adjustment without resorting to pesticide applications. The cornerstone of chemical-free pest control initiates with detailed blocking work – sealing cracks, holes, and openings that enable organisms to invade buildings in the beginning place. Setting up door sweeps, restoring deteriorated screens, and filling utility access points eliminates usual invasion locations. Taking away food resources through suitable meal containment in closed receptacles, quick removal of drops and crumbs, and regular trash disposal markedly minimizes lures that attract organisms inside. Reducing dampness by mending dripping pipes, enhancing ventilation in damp zones, and dealing with water flow problems removes the moisture supplies many pests call for. Maintaining a space zone around structures by reducing greenery, removing leaf litter, and keeping timber off the ground and apart from structures lowers shelter areas and penetration points. Applying solid obstacles like metal wire or metal material to seal wider openings provides permanent exclusion for rodents and rats. Frequent sanitation that contains vacuuming openings and crevices eliminates pest eggs and nutrition debris that maintain pest growth. For active issues, though, some form of management product may be needed to resolve confirmed troubles, though many minimal-impact options are available such as diatomaceous material, boric powder, and pest-killing soaps that deliver reduced hazard against standard products.
